Just saw this 3rd party pad from Saitek for the 360 at Play-Asia; notable because you can rotate the left stick and the d-pad to make it resemble a DualShock controller. Not sure what I mean?

pa.148030.2.jpg


Is anyone familiar with this pad? I kinda want to buy one, but I'm curious as to if it just switches the location of the stick and d-pad, or if it switches functions as well. For example, in Gears of War, you switch weapons using the d-pad. If you got the Cyborg pad and swapped the locations of the left stick and d-pad, would it make you switch weapons with the left stick?
